    Overview

    Sangfor HCI is an IT infrastructure platform built on converged architecture. It integrates server virtualization, distributed storage, and networking. Sangfor HCI provides a unified management platform that converges compute, storage, networking, and security on a single software stack. This approach delivers a simplified architecture, ease of use, and reliability for business-critical applications.

    Hyperconverged infrastructure is a unified system of data storage. HCI combines storage, computing, networking, and management, unlike traditional storage solutions. HCI systems enable you to build your private cloud, expand to a public cloud, or have your own true hybrid cloud. Sangfor HCI presents two product models: The Sangfor HCI server appliance is a hardware version that enables easy deployment. Sangfor HCI software is the digital version combined with a third-party server that enables flexible deployment.

    Sangfor HCI supports Windows systems on desktop and is web-based. Its range of use cases cover a wide spectrum of industries, from healthcare to manufacturing. It is applicable for mid- and large-sized businesses. The software is customizable. Users can customize the logo and contact information in the user interface.

    Benefits and Features

    • Stability: Sangfor HCI delivers high reliability and availability with 0 RPO and 99.99% availability. The infrastructure is fully redundant to ensure business continuity. This means no data is lost in the event of hardware failure.
    • Simplified infrastructure: The solution supports visual management, making it easier to use. The single platform provides a central control with access to resources.
    • High performance: One unit of HCI can support up to 100,000 IOPS. The solution supports data striping, data locality, SSD caching and AI-based DB optimization. It also supports linear expansion without bottlenecks.
    • Hyper-converged infrastructure that enables working with different scenarios. For instance, cloud transformation and data center consolidation. It is fully converged, which means it provides unified management, full resource visualization, and orchestration with SCP. The standardized HCI unit consolidates hardware appliances, a storage network, IP network, and server into a single unit.
    • Integration: Sangfor HCI offers deep integration with NFV components. Users can deploy complex SDN networks.
    • Pay-as-you-grow model: The pay-per-use model reduces operational expenses and total cost of ownership.

    Use Cases

    Sangfor HCI can be applied tin various scenarios:

    • Enterprise applications: Users can benefit from the reliability and performance of Sangfor HCI for business-critical processes. The system is optimized for enterprise applications to enhance their performance and stability.
    • Datacenter consolidation: The unified and software-defined technology simplifies the operational management and the architecture of data centers.
    • Cloud transformation: You can add a cloud management platform, transforming Sangfor HCI into a complete cloud computing solution. You can then run your cloud workloads and benefit from the automation features of Sangfor HCI.
    • Data protection and recovery: Sangfor HCI offers multiple data protection features, such as continuous data protection (CDP), which ensure the integrity of sensitive and user data. You can protect backup snapshots and take backups. It records virtual machine IO logs at frequent intervals. It offers disaster recovery capabilities that ensure business continuity.

    VMware Cloud Director, also known as vCloud Director, is a cloud management tool that offers secure, flexible, and efficient cloud resources to thousands of enterprises and IT teams across the world. The solution serves as one of the leading cloud service-delivery platforms for businesses that want to manage and operate their services effectively. By deploying this solution, companies can benefit from virtualized networking, computing, security, and storage. These benefits can be received in a timely manner, as the infrastructure of the product is operationally ready within minutes and clients do not need to install and configure physical infrastructure.

    One of the biggest advantages of vCloud Director is that it allows users to build cloud-ready applications. In several ways, it facilitates the process for developers, including:

    • Open to DevOps: The product addresses the needs of DevOps teams by providing Infrastructure as Code services with vCD Terraform Provider. This allows developers to deliver infrastructure directly from code. Additionally, it provides capabilities from Python and vCD API as well as Object Storage API and App Launchpad APIs.

    • Customization: This solution is very customizable and extensible for cloud providers to deliver their own branding, themes, and services to their clients.

    • Dev-ready cloud: vCloud Director offers support for Tanzu Kubernetes Grid for vSphere and multicloud with a plugin for container service extension. Through these, native K8s Clusters or Tanzu Kubernetes Grid Clusters can be delivered and managed through a user interface (UI) and application programming interface (API).

    vCloud Director Features

    This VMware product has various features through which users can virtualize their data and benefit from quality management solutions. Among the popular capabilities of vCloud Director are:

    • Elastic secure virtual data centers: This vCloud Director feature provides tenants with securely isolated virtual resources, fine-grained control of their public cloud services, and independent role-based authentication.

    • Multi-site management: This feature allows companies to stretch data centers across sites and geographies as well as connect to existing dedicated vCenters for access and management or on-broad into VMware vCloud Director.

    • ISV ecosystem: This feature integrates leading cloud service vendors into the product using an open extensibility framework. Some of the partners of vCloud Director include Dell Data Protection, Veeam, Cloudian, AWS S3, and Dell ECS.

    • DRaaS workload protection: This feature allows users to deliver self-service tiered disaster recovery as a service (DRaaS) on-premises to cloud and cloud to cloud.

    • Cloud migration: Part of this feature is the plugin VMware Cloud Director Availability, which enables simple migration to cloud, offering self-service cold or warm migration to users' vCloud Director clouds.

    • Operational visibility and insights: The product includes an accessible dashboard and a single pane of glass to provide centralized multi-tenant cloud management views.

    • Cloud-native applications and development: This feature makes the platform suitable for developers to sandbox or deploy apps as it natively supports Tanzu Basic, native K8s, and PKS.

    • Automation: Through various tools and deep integration, the solution allows users to automate complex infrastructure-as-code and tile UI-driven workflows. This allows them to deploy X-as-a-Service and maintain full access control and visibility at the same time.

    • Application Platform as a Service: This feature enables users to deliver their own catalog-based applications or VMware Cloud Marketplace-certified third-party cloud applications through the plugin App Launchpad VMware Cloud Director.

    • GPU as a Service: Utilizing Nvidia AI Enterprise, this feature provides support for GPU as a Service and delivers multi-tenant GPU services for customers who require high-performance compute for GPU-specific applications.

    • Secure cloud: The solution supports multiple security-centric features to deliver an enterprise-class cloud service, including NSX-T distributed firewalling, workload encryption, and integrated disaster recovery replication.

    vCloud Director Benefits

    VMware vCloud Director offers various benefits to its users. Some of these include:

    • The solution provides a highly efficient self-service model which consists of a virtual data center compute, network, storage, and security.

    • VMware vCloud Director offers its users multi-tenancy infrastructure with deep automation which facilitates their daily tasks.

    • The product is cost-efficient, as it is service-ready on its very first day and offers a high revenue from services.

    • Businesses can deliver services to their clients in a timely manner through this product, benefitting from its natively integrated solutions.

    • VMware vCloud Director provides users with high flexibility, as it allows businesses to stretch networks across virtual data centers globally.

    • The solution provides load-balancing capabilities, which facilitate the creation of new hybrid applications and digital transformation initiatives.
